Skip to content
This repository has been archived by the owner on Dec 4, 2018. It is now read-only.
LikeLakers2 edited this page Feb 13, 2017 · 11 revisions

Hello, I'm Mettaton, an RP bot built for the needs of the Official /r/Undertale Discord Roleplay. (That's a mouthful, ain't it?) I'm here to help automate some processes. Most importantly, I keep an automated log of the roleplay channels, so we don't lose everything should the channels be suddenly deleted again.

Command Conventions

Any time you see < > around a parameter, that means it's required. You MUST specify these parameters.

Any time you see [ ] around a parameter, that means it's optional. You are not required to specify these parameters.

Do not include < > or [ ] around your parameters when executing commands.


To force a parameter to have spaces, put "quotes" around your parameter. For example, rp!set <ID> Name "Mr. Bags" will force "Mr. Bags" to be one parameter rather than two.

My normal invoker is rp!, however you may also use these in place of that: mtt!, mettaton!, :mttyeah:, :mttoh:

PLEASE NOTE THAT THIS HELP MAY BE OUTDATED IN SOME PARTS AND COMMANDS MAY NOT FUNCTION EXACTLY AS DESCRIBED.

If there is any discrepency and the bot is not helping, please feel free to ping **MichiRecRoom#9507**.

This help text will eventually be transferred over to external service (Dropbox or Github Wiki pages), but for now please understand.

Commands

Commands that are in bold require admin access. Click on a command to view more about it.

Category Command Description Aliases
Archival rp!archive Archival feature similar to 42 and Beta 42's +archive command.
rp!archivechan Manages my channels that will automatically be logged to file.
Character Manager rp!register Register a character for roleplay. This is done in PM, and you are able to exit at any time.
rp!charmanage Manages characters, as well as listing them. For more info, and a list of sub-commands, check out the help for this command. rp!cm
Role Management rp!giveme Gives you access to the roleplay channels.
rp!<rolecommand> Gives the role to someone. Multiple people can be specified.
Misc rp!diceroll Roll some dice. Useful if you need a quick random number. Aliases: rp!roll, rp!dr rp!role rp!ignore
Admin rp!ignore Manages my ignore list -- people on this list will not be able to use commands.
Secret rp!????? ...
Clone this wiki locally